    Nisin CAS:1414-45-5

    Food additives Preservative Nisin Nisin CAS:1414-45-5 is white crystalline particle or crystalline powder, with slightly propionic acid odor. Stable to heat and light, easily soluble in water. Calcium acetate can be used in bread, cookie, cheese and other foods as preservative, as antiseptic in feed industry, and mineral additive. It can also used in pharma and feed industry. Specification: Nisin   pharma grade  Nisin Industrial grade Nisin   Food grade   * Please refer to Certificate of Analysis for lot specific data.  Application: 1) Nisin is  used in meat products, dairy products, canned products, seafood, beverage, fruit juice beverage, liquid egg and egg products, condiments, brewing technology, baked goods, convenience food, aromatic spices, cosmetics and other fields. 2) Nisin is a Adding into food can greatly reduce the sterilization temperature of food, shorten the sterilization time of food, so that the food can maintain the original nutritional composition, flavor, color 3) Nisin is in dairy products, meat products, fruit drinks, vegetable protein drinks, beer and other widely used. Lactostreptosin has been used in the following aspects: A. In dairy products, such as cheese, sterilized milk and flavored milk, the dosage is 1-10mg/kg. B. Used for canned food, such as pineapple, cherry, apple, peach, green bean canned and tomato sauce, the dosage is 2-2.5mg/kg. C. For cooked food, such as pudding 4) Nisin is a narrow-spectrum antimicrobial agent that only kills and inhibits gram-positive bacteria, not yeasts, Gram-negative bacteria, and molds. Our country specifies that can be used for meat products and dairy products, the maximum dosage is 0.5g/kg; Maximum use 0.2g/kg in vegetable protein drinks and cans.     SODIUM LAURETH SULFATE 1EO CAS NO: 9004-82-4

    Sodium Laureth Sulfate 1EO refers to sodium lauryl ether sulfate, a common anionic surfactant, where 1EO indicates that the lauryl hydrophobic chain in its molecule is connected to one ethoxy (-CH₂CH₂O-) unit. Basic Structure and Properties Chemical Structure: Its general structural formula is:CH3(CH2)10CH2(OCH2CH2)1OSO3Na.   It consists of three parts: Hydrophobic group: Lauryl group (C12 alkyl chain) Connecting group: 1 ethoxy unit Hydrophilic group: Sodium sulfate ester group Core Performance Excellent surface activity: It can significantly reduce the surface tension of water, and has strong emulsifying, detergency, and foaming abilities, producing rich and stable foam. Improved water solubility: Compared to sodium lauryl sulfate (SLS) without ethoxy groups, the introduction of one ethoxy unit improves its water solubility, making it less likely to precipitate at low temperatures. Optimized mildness: It is slightly less irritating than SLS, but still belongs to the category of moderately irritating surfactants, suitable for cleaning products. Hard water resistance: It has stronger hard water resistance than SLS, maintaining good cleaning performance in water containing calcium and magnesium ions. Compatibility: It can be compounded with nonionic, cationic (caution is needed to avoid precipitation), and other anionic surfactants. Main Application Areas Personal care products: Used in shampoos, shower gels, facial cleansers, hand soaps, etc., playing a core role in cleaning and foaming. Due to the low number of EO units, it has strong detergency and is often compounded with mild surfactants (such as cocamidopropyl betaine) to reduce irritation. Household cleaning products: Used in laundry detergents, dishwashing detergents, hard surface cleaners, etc., utilizing its emulsifying and foaming abilities to improve cleaning efficiency. Industrial field: It can be used as an emulsifier in pesticide and paint formulations, and also as a wetting agent in the textile industry and a degreasing agent in the leather industry. Differences from similar products Product Eo Number Water-Soluble Mildness Detergency SLS 0 General Lower Strong SLES-1EO 1 Better Moderate Stronger SLES-2EO/3EO 2-3 Very Good Higher Moderate Precautions: At high concentrations, it can be irritating to the skin and eyes. The proportion added to formulations needs to be controlled (usually 5%-15% in personal care products). Avoid high temperatures and strong acidic environments during storage, otherwise hydrolysis may occur, reducing its activity.

    SODIUM LAURETH SULPHATE 3EO CAS NO: 9004-82-4

    Sodium Laureth Sulfate 3EO (SLES-3EO) is an anionic surfactant.  3EO indicates that its molecule contains 3 ethoxy (-CH₂CH₂O-) units attached to the lauryl hydrophobic chain. It is a widely used mild surfactant in the daily chemical and cleaning industries. Basic Structure and Properties Chemical Structure: The general structural formula is: CH3(CH2)10CH2(OCH2CH2)3OSO3Na. It mainly consists of three parts: Hydrophobic group: Lauryl group (C₁₂ alkyl chain) Connecting group: 3 ethoxy units Hydrophilic group: Sodium sulfate ester group Core Performance Outstanding Mildness: Compared to SLS (0EO) and SLES-1EO, the introduction of 3 ethoxy units significantly reduces skin and eye irritation, making it a commonly used mild cleansing and foaming ingredient in personal care products. Excellent Water Solubility: The increased number of ethoxy units enhances hydrophilicity, maintaining good solubility even at low temperatures and preventing precipitation and stratification. Balanced Foaming and Cleaning: It produces rich and dense foam that is easy to rinse off, and has moderate cleaning power, effectively cleaning grease and dirt without excessive degreasing that leads to dry skin. Strong Hard Water Resistance: It exhibits good stability in hard water containing calcium and magnesium ions, and the cleaning effect does not significantly decrease. Good Compatibility: It can be compounded with non-ionic and amphoteric surfactants (such as cocamidopropyl betaine, alkyl glycosides), further improving mildness and foaming properties; caution is needed when compounding with cationic surfactants to avoid precipitation. Main Application Areas Personal Care Products It is a core ingredient in shampoos, shower gels, facial cleansers, and baby care products, especially suitable for sensitive skin and infant care formulations, with a typical addition ratio of 5%–20%. Household Cleaning Products Used in dishwashing detergents, laundry detergents, hand soaps, etc., balancing cleaning power and mildness, reducing irritation to the skin of the hands. Industrial Applications It can be used as a wetting agent in the textile industry, a pesticide emulsifier, and a leather degreasing agent, achieving efficient processing under mild conditions. Differences from similar products Product Eo Number Water-Soluble Mildness Detergency SLS 0 General Lower Strong SLES-1EO 1 Better Moderate Stronger SLES-2EO/3EO 2-3 Very Good Higher Moderate Precautions: Although generally mild, high concentrations (>20%) may still irritate sensitive skin; therefore, the amount used in formulations should be controlled. Store in a sealed container in a cool, dry place, avoiding contact with strong acids and high temperatures to prevent hydrolysis and loss of activity.
